A joint resolution of the Senate and the House of Representatives of the state of montana commemorating St. Patrick's Day, celebrating the contributions of montanans of Irish heritage, and expressing the hope that the calm and cooperation that the 1998 Good Friday Agreement has engendered in Ireland will endure.
Now, therefore, be it resolved by the Senate and the House of Representatives OF THE STATE OF MONTANA:
That the Montana Legislature commemorates St. Patrick's Day, celebrates the contributions of Montanans of Irish heritage, and expresses the hope that the calm and cooperation that the 1998 Good Friday Agreement has engendered in Ireland will endure.
BE IT FURTHER RESOLVED, that the Secretary of State send a copy of this resolution to the National Co-Chairs of the American Irish State Legislators Caucus, to Senator Mark Daly, the Cathaoirleach of Seanad Éireann (Chair of the Senate of Ireland), and to Deputy Seán Ó Fearghail, the Ceann Comhairle of Dáil Éireann (Chair of the Assembly of Ireland).
